Only the Infinix GT 30 5G+ (D8350 Apex) is officially Krafton-certified for 90fps BGMI. The iQOO Z10 and vivo T4 (Snapdragon 7s Gen 3) can run BGMI at 60fps smoothly on HDR settings. The Dimensity 7300/7400 phones handle 60fps at high settings comfortably.
Yes, 8GB RAM is sufficient for all current mobile games including BGMI, Free Fire, and Genshin Impact. The realme NARZO 80 Pro with 12GB RAM offers an advantage only in multitasking (switching between games and other apps without reloading). For pure gaming, 8GB is adequate.
The iQOO Z10 (7300mAh + 90W) and vivo T4 (7300mAh + 90W) offer the longest gaming battery life — roughly 5-6 hours of continuous gaming. The realme 15 (7000mAh + 80W) and realme P4 (7000mAh + 80W) are close seconds.
All phones generate some heat during intensive gaming. The Infinix GT 30 5G+ and iQOO Z10 have the fewest heating complaints in reviews. The realme NARZO 80 Pro has the most heating complaints — multiple reviewers report thermal throttling during extended gaming.
Several phones already offer 144Hz (Infinix GT 30, realme 15, realme P4, Moto G96) at no premium over 120Hz options. There's no reason to wait — 144Hz options are available now. Choose based on overall package (processor, battery, build) rather than refresh rate alone.
Vivo/iQOO and realme have the widest service center networks in India. Motorola's service is limited in tier-2/3 cities. Infinix has fewer service centers but is expanding. For gaming phones that may see heavy use, service network availability is an important consideration.
Physical gaming triggers are shoulder buttons (like console controllers) that provide tactile feedback and faster response. The Infinix GT 30 5G+ is the only phone under 30K with physical triggers, giving a significant competitive advantage in BGMI and COD Mobile. They allow 4-finger claw gameplay without screen obstruction.
